Citroën presents new ë-Berlingo electric van

Citroën has unveiled the new ë-Berlingo panel van, which is scheduled to go on sale in the fourth quarter of 2021 and completes Citroën’s trio of electric commercial vehicles after the ë-Jumpy and the ë-Jumper.

Peugeot looks to use ACC battery cells in e-3008

Peugeot plans to launch the all-electric e-3008 in autumn 2023. The electric SUV will sit on the new all-electric platform eVMP and feature battery cells from Automotive Cell Company (ACC), the joint venture from Total and PSA subsidiaries Saft and Opel.

PSA building chargers for European employees

The French automotive group PSA has announced that it will establish charging infrastructures for its employees at all European locations. By the end of 2021, almost 500 charging stations are to be installed at 49 Group sites in twelve countries.

Stellantis can choose from three EV platforms

The planned merger of the car companies PSA and FCA under the name Stellantis will apparently be able to rely on three electric car platforms. In addition to the existing platforms eCMP and eVMP, according to a new report from Italy, a base developed by FCA will also trade for larger electric cars.

PSA launch the ACC battery cell joint venture

The French automotive group PSA with its German subsidiary Opel and the French energy group Total with its subsidiary Saft have now signed an agreement to set up the Automotive Cells Company (ACC) joint venture.

PSA has a major order for SVOLT

According to insiders, SVOLT, the battery cell manufacturer that emerged from the Chinese car manufacturer Great Wall, has received a large order from the French PSA group. SVOLT will supply PSA with battery cells with a total capacity of more than 7 GWh.

PSA Group announces eVMP electric platform for 2023

The French car group PSA has announced a purely-electric car platform when the Group presented its half-yearly figures. PSA is deviating from the previous multi-energy strategy with the special e-platform called the Electric Vehicle Modular Platform (eVMP).
